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ements are a fundamental aspect of most online casino bonuses. These requirements specify the amount of money a player must wager before they can withdraw any winnings earned from bonus funds.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if a player receives a $100 bonus, they must wager $3,000 ($100 x 30) before they can cash out their winnings. Different games contribute differently towards meeting the wagering requirements. Slot games typ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ute a smaller percentage. Understanding these contributions is crucial for effectively managing your bonus and maximizing your chances of meeting the wagering requirements.

It’s also important to be aware of the time limits associated with wagering requirements. Most bonuses have an expiration date, and if the wagering requirements are not met within that timeframe, the bonus and any associated winnings will be forfeited. Therefore, it's essential to plan your gameplay accordingly and prioritize meeting the wagering requirements before the bonus expires. Ensuring Responsible Gaming Practices

While online casinos offer an exciting form of entertainment, it’s vital to prioritize responsible gaming practices. Gaming should be viewed as a leisure activity, not as a source of income. Setting a budget and sticking to it is crucial for preventing financial problems.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ly lead to escalating debts. It’s also important to be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more time and money than intended, lying to others about your gambling habits, and feeling restless or irritable when not gambling.

Many online casinos offer t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its. These include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to responsible gambling organizations.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they can deposit into their account within a specified period. Loss lim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they are willing to lose. Self-exclusion allows players to temporarily or permanently block themselves from accessing the casino. Utilizing these tools can help players maintain control over their gambling and prevent potential problems.
